Full job description
Gourmet Food Parlour is thrilled to offer an exciting opportunity for a dedicated, enthusiastic, and ambitious Assistant Manager to join our team at our beautiful Malahide restaurant.
Located between the picturesque villages of Malahide and Portmarnock, our restaurant boasts stunning coastal views and offers a predominantly daytime role with an excellent work-life balance.
This is a fantastic opportunity for an experienced hospitality professional looking to take the next step in their management career. The ideal candidate will be passionate about delivering exceptional customer experiences, leading and developing a high-performing team, and supporting the Restaurant Manager in the day-to-day running of the business.
Key Responsibilities
- Support the Restaurant Manager in the day-to-day operation of the restaurant.
- Lead the team by example, ensuring outstanding customer service at all times.
- Assist in achieving financial targets through effective labour, stock and cost management.
- Manage daily cash handling and ensure company procedures are followed.
- Maintain optimum stock levels and assist with ordering and stock control.
- Prepare and coordinate employee rotas to ensure efficient staffing levels.
- Ensure compliance with all food safety, HACCP, health & safety and cleaning standards.
- Train, coach and develop team members to achieve their full potential.
- Assist with recruitment, onboarding and performance management.
- Build strong working relationships with the kitchen team to ensure excellent service and food quality.
- Liaise daily with the Operations and Reservations teams to ensure smooth service and successful event execution.
- Resolve customer queries professionally and efficiently.
- Promote Gourmet Food Parlour's brand values and maintain high operational standards.
- Step into the Restaurant Manager's role when required.
Key Competencies
- Inspires, motivates and develops others.
- Strong leadership and organisational skills.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
- Customer-focused with a passion for hospitality.
- Commercially aware with strong attention to detail.
- Ability to prioritise and manage multiple tasks in a fast-paced environment.
- Confident decision-maker and effective problem solver.
- Strong knowledge of food safety and HACCP procedures.
- Proficient in Microsoft Office and hospitality management systems.
- Flexible, proactive and eager to learn.
Criteria for Application
- Minimum 2 years' experience in a supervisory or management role within hospitality.
- Minimum 3 years' experience in the hospitality industry.
- Previous experience in a busy cafe or restaurant environment is desirable.
- Excellent leadership and people management skills.
- Strong knowledge of HACCP and food safety standards.
- Excellent spoken and written English.
- A positive attitude with a hands-on approach to leadership.
Benefits
- Predominantly daytime role with excellent work-life balance.
- Beautiful seaside location in Malahide.
- Competitive salary.
- On-site parking.
- Comprehensive training and development platform.
- Employee Assistance Programme.
- Tips.
- Free coffee.
- Subsidised meals while on duty.
- Staff discount across all Gourmet Food Parlour locations.
- Career progression opportunities within a growing Irish hospitality group.
